07:09Red Bull lost the Constructors' Championship in 2024
07:14That is the most important championship
07:17That's where the prize fund money comes from
07:20That keeps that team on the racetrack
07:22They lost because they only had one car scoring points
07:28Christian needs someone in that second seat alongside Max Verstappen
07:33That can score points consistently
07:35Or senior figures at Red Bull won't be happy
07:39Christian is answerable to a board in Austria
07:43And that's run by Oliver Mintzlab
07:46With Helmut Marko as his advisor
